The Rising Demand for Oncology Products in Jordan

Jordan’s healthcare system benefits from strong institutions such as the King Hussein Cancer Center (KHCC), university hospitals, and the Royal Medical Services. Recent initiatives include government-funded treatment coverage for millions of citizens, free care for pediatric cancer patients, and participation in global platforms that supply essential childhood cancer medicines. These steps increase demand for reliable supplies of chemotherapy agents, targeted therapies, supportive care products, and emerging treatments such as radiopharmaceuticals and cell therapies.

Local manufacturing capacity is expanding. Jordan hosts established pharmaceutical companies with dedicated oncology facilities, and new projects—such as the first private radiopharmaceutical manufacturing site in the Middle East—aim to reduce import dependence for diagnostic and therapeutic isotopes used in thyroid, neuroendocrine, and prostate cancers. Despite these advances, a significant share of specialized oncology products still relies on international supply chains. This creates opportunities for partnerships with experienced oncology products manufacturing companies that meet rigorous quality standards.

Emerging Trends in Oncology Products Manufacturing

Several key trends are shaping oncology manufacturing and supply for markets like Jordan:

  • High-potency and complex formulations: Oncology products often require specialized containment, sterile processing, and controlled environments. Manufacturers with WHO-GMP and EU-GMP certified facilities are better positioned to deliver consistent quality for cytotoxic and high-potency molecules.
  • Generic and biosimilar expansion: Cost-effective generics and biosimilars improve access while maintaining therapeutic equivalence. Contract and third-party manufacturing models allow local importers and distributors to launch or expand oncology portfolios under their own brands.
  • Radiopharmaceuticals and advanced therapies: Regional investment in isotope production and CAR-T-related capacity signals a shift toward more sophisticated, localized solutions. Partnerships that support technology transfer or reliable supply of complementary products accelerate this transition.
  • Regulatory alignment and export readiness: Manufacturers experienced in documentation, registration support, and compliance with Jordan Food and Drug Administration requirements streamline market entry.
  • Supply chain resilience: Flexible minimum order quantities, dedicated export teams, and end-to-end logistics help Jordanian partners manage demand fluctuations and reduce stock-out risks.

These trends favor collaboration with established oncology products manufacturing companies that combine technical capability with export expertise.
